Defining Password Aging<br />

The duration of password validity is determined by the value of the<br />

PASSWORD_EXPIRATION_DAYS System Flag.<br />

• Passwords can be set to be valid for durations of between 0 and 90<br />

days.<br />

• If the System Flag is set to 0, user passwords do not expire. The System<br />

Flag cannot be set to 0 when the <strong>RMX</strong> is in Enhanced Security Mode.<br />

• In Enhanced Security Mode, the minimum duration can be set to 7 days<br />

and the default duration is 60 days.<br />

The display of a warning to the user of the number of days until password<br />

expiration is determined by the value of the<br />

PASSWORD_EXPIRATION_WARNING_DAYS System Flag.<br />

• Possible number of days to display expiry warnings is between 0 and<br />

14.<br />

• If the System Flag is set to 0, password expiry warnings are not<br />

displayed. The System Flag cannot be set to 0 when the <strong>RMX</strong> is in<br />

Enhanced Security Mode.<br />

• In Enhanced Security Mode, the earliest warning can be displayed 14<br />

days before passwords are due to expire and the latest warning can<br />

be displayed 7 days before passwords are due to expire (default<br />

setting).<br />

• If a user attempts to log in after his/her password has expired, an<br />

error is displayed: User must change password.<br />

Defining Password Change Frequency<br />

The frequency with which a user can change a password is determined by<br />

the value of the MIN_PWD_CHANGE_FREQUENCY_IN_DAYS System<br />

Flag. The value of the flag is the number of days that users must retain a<br />

password.<br />

• Possible retention period is between 0 and 7 days. In Enhanced<br />

Security Mode the retention period is between 1 (default) and 7.<br />

• If the System Flag is set to 0, users do not have to change their<br />

passwords. The System Flag cannot be set to 0 when the <strong>RMX</strong> is in<br />

Enhanced Security Mode.<br />

• If a user attempts to change a password within the time period<br />

specified by this flag, an error, Password change is not allowed before<br />

defined min time has passed, is displayed.
